Google cloud shell

Google cloud shell. Cloud Shell is a browser-based environment that lets you manage your Google Cloud resources and develop your cloud-based apps. Sep 10, 2024 · A roster of go-to commands for the Google Cloud CLI, the primary command-line tool for Google Cloud. Use the `cloudshell` command to accomplish Cloud Shell tasks. txt', from Cloud Shell to your local machine: For example, to move a file, 'data. google. This security feature requires that you verify that the multiline text that you want to paste into the shell doesn't contain malicious scripts. Create or select a Google Cloud project. Sep 9, 2024 · Learn how to use Cloud Shell, a virtual machine with command-line access to Google Cloud resources, and the gcloud tool. For more detail, see the reference documentation for gcloud cloud-shell. GOOGLE_CLOUD_PROJECT , the environmental variable used by Application Default Credentials library support to define project ID, is also set to point to the active project in Cloud Shell. Use Cloud Shell from a local machine with the gcloud CLI. Use Cloud Shell with the Google Cloud CLI. Create a custom Cloud Shell experience with additional packages and custom configurations. Tip: You can also launch the Cloud Shell Editor by navigating to ide. Cloud Shell provides command-line access to your Google Cloud Sep 10, 2024 · If you're using Google Cloud, create a Google Cloud project and then enable billing. Click stop Stop, and then click Stop to confirm. Sep 10, 2024 · Learn how to use the Cloud Shell Terminal, a command-line tool that opens in the Google Cloud console. instanceAdmin. txt', from Cloud Shell to your local machine: Apr 12, 2024 · Google Cloud Shell is a counterpart of Azure Cloud Shell, and it can be used to develop, test, debug, and deploy cloud-based instances. Jan 26, 2024 · Note: To view a menu with a list of Google Cloud products and services, click the Navigation menu at the top-left. Note: If you don't plan to keep the resources that you create in this procedure, create a project instead of selecting an existing project. Select the VMs to stop. For example, a filename of my-ssh-key generates a private key file named my-ssh-key and a public key file named my-ssh-key. The script field takes a single string value. Not your computer? Use a private browsing window to sign in. Enable the Cloud SQL Admin API. Try it for yourself If you're new to Google Cloud, create an account to evaluate how our products perform in real-world scenarios. Click Activate Cloud Shell at the top of the Google Cloud console. We invite you to try the Cloud Shell Editor via our GKE and Cloud Run quickstart, or access it directly from ide. Sign in to your Google Cloud account. In Cloud Shell, click the Open Editor icon and then click on the Open in a new window link. Projects allow you to collect the related resources for a single application in one place, manage APIs, enable Google Cloud services, add and remove collaborators, and manage permissions for Google Cloud resources. Sep 5, 2024 · Run C++ Examples in Cloud Shell. ssh/KEY_FILENAME-C USERNAME Replace the following: KEY_FILENAME: the name for your SSH key file. Open the Cloud Shell Editor. Learn more about Google Cloud Shell features and benefits at the link provided in the video description. A new tab opens with the Cloud Shell Editor. This repository contains tutorials to help you make the most of Cloud Shell. Connect to compute services, configure your environment, and practice using gcloud commands in this hands-on lab. To create a VM and add a public SSH key to instance metadata at the same time using the gcloud CLI, use the gcloud compute instances create command : patch-partner-metadata; perform-maintenance; remove-iam-policy-binding; remove-labels; remove-metadata; remove-partner-metadata; remove-resource-policies Sep 10, 2024 · Console . For more information, see Authorize with Cloud Shell. In short, Cloud Code is a powerful tool that can speed up your workflow when developing cloud-native applications. gcloud CLI provides two options: Google Cloud SDK, languages, frameworks, and tools Infrastructure as code Migration Google Cloud Home Free Trial and Free Tier Architecture Center Blog Contact Sales Google Cloud Developer Center Google Developer Center Google Cloud Marketplace Google Cloud Marketplace Documentation Google Cloud Skills Boost Sep 10, 2024 · Cloud Shell. It has a terminal with preloaded utilities, an online editor with debugger and source control, and 5 GB of persistent storage. Example workflow Jan 24, 2022 · With Cloud Shell, the Cloud SDK gcloud command and other utilities you need are always available when you need them. App development can be performed from the browser itself, and a host of different options are available for users to optimize their processes. patch-partner-metadata; perform-maintenance; remove-iam-policy-binding; remove-labels; remove-metadata; remove-partner-metadata; remove-resource-policies Nov 28, 2019 · Cloud Shell には、週 60 時間の使用権限があります。上限に達した場合は、しばらく待機してから、Cloud Shell の使用を再開する必要があります。また、Cloud Shell に 120 日間アクセスしないと、ホームディスクが削除されてしまいます。 6. Read the Cloud Shell documentation. (Also included: introductory primer , understanding commands , and a printable PDF . Service Level Agreement for Cloud Shell. Watch a short video tutorial on how to use Google Cloud Shell, an in browser terminal for managing your Google Cloud Platform projects. A quota restricts how much of a Google Cloud resource your Google Cloud project can use. 0 License , and code samples are licensed under the Apache 2. v1) IAM role on the project. Open Cloud Shell Sep 10, 2024 · Use the gcloud cloud-shell scp command on a local terminal to transfer files between Cloud Shell and your workstation. Cloud Shell can be used to run the gcloud commands presented throughout this quickstart. Application Development Sep 10, 2024 · Cloud Shell creates in-context tutorials from these Markdown files by parsing the text into steps and substeps that are then displayed in a panel in Google Cloud console. Use the cloudshell command. To download the sample code and change into the app directory, click Proceed. Generate gcloud commands for common Google Cloud console tasks using Cloud Shell. It can take a few seconds for the session to be initialized. What's next. Sep 10, 2024 · In the Google Cloud console, activate Cloud Shell. To stop one or more VMs, do the following: In the Google Cloud console, go to the VM instances page. Required roles. Make sure that you leave the options to start the shell and configure your installation selected. 0 License . Open in Cloud Shell repositories patch-partner-metadata; perform-maintenance; remove-iam-policy-binding; remove-labels; remove-metadata; remove-partner-metadata; remove-resource-policies 4 days ago · In the Google Cloud console, activate Cloud Shell. In the gcloud CLI, use the gcloud compute disks resize command and specify the --size flag with the desired disk size, in gigabytes. You can prefix the string value with a shebang to specify the shell to interpret the script. Overview Cloud Shell is an online development and operations environment accessible anywhere with your browser. It is a Debian-based virtual machine with a persistent 5 GB home directory, allowing users to manage their GCP resources and projects directly from their web browser. Learn about tutorials (using a tutorial!) The Cloud9 code editor and integrated debugger include helpful, time-saving features such as code hinting, code completion, and step-through debugging. Learn more about using Guest mode Google Cloud Shell is an online, browser-based command-line environment provided by Google Cloud Platform (GCP). You can manage your resources with its online terminal preloaded with utilities such as the gcloud command-line tool, kubectl, and more. Find out about persistent disk storage, authorization, environment variables, zone selection, image rollout, and more. Find quickstarts, guides, tutorials, and reference materials for Cloud Shell features and tools. com Sep 10, 2024 · Learn how to use Cloud Shell, an interactive shell environment for Google Cloud that lets you manage your projects and resources from your web browser. You can switch between Cloud Shell and the code editor by clicking the tab. In Cloud Shell, configure the gcloud tool to use your new Google Cloud project: Sep 10, 2024 · The Open in Cloud Shell feature allows you to publish a link that opens the Google Cloud console with a Git repository cloned into Cloud Shell and/or starts Cloud Shell with a custom image. Sep 5, 2024 · For example, you can create clusters hosted on Google Cloud, and have better integration with tools like Cloud Source Repositories, Cloud Build, and Cloud Client Libraries. Authorization When scripting with gcloud CLI, you'll need to consider authorization methods. Use the side bar on the left to browse the file Sep 10, 2024 · This page contains instructions for choosing and maintaining a Google Cloud CLI installation. pub. The Google Cloud console and Cloud Shell remain on the original tab. New customers also get $300 in free credits to Sep 10, 2024 · This document lists the quotas and limits that apply to Cloud Shell. Cloud Shell is a virtual machine that is loaded with development tools. To get the permissions that you need to create VMs, ask your administrator to grant you the Compute Instance Admin (v1) (roles/compute. Sep 6, 2024 · A Google Cloud project is required to use Google Workspace APIs and build Google Workspace add-ons or apps. Google Cloud Google Cloud Shell is a hosted development environment managing resources hosted on Google Cloud Platform. Google Cloud Platform lets you build, deploy, and scale applications, websites, and services on the same infrastructure as Google. You can find the online documentation here. At the bottom of the Google Cloud console, a Cloud Shell session starts and displays a command-line prompt. In this codelab, you will learn how to connect to computing resources hosted on Google Cloud Platform via the web. Sep 10, 2024 · Cloud Build provides a script field that you can use to specify shell scripts to execute in a build step. It offers a persistent 5GB home directory and runs on the Google Cloud. Safe Paste for text input. Inactive and long-running sessions are automatically stopped and recycled. Cloud Shell provides command-line access to your Google Cloud resources directly from the browser. Sep 10, 2024 · This page describes how to start and set up a new Cloud Shell session. Cloud Shell is a shell environment with the Google Cloud CLI already installed and with values already set for your current project. Google Cloud Sep 10, 2024 · Google Cloud SDK, languages, frameworks, and tools Infrastructure as code Cloud Shell opens the preview URL on its proxy service in a new browser window. The editor opens above the Cloud Shell terminal window. Sep 10, 2024 · ssh-keygen -t rsa -f ~/. Sep 10, 2024 · Learn how Cloud Shell provides a temporary Linux virtual machine for your Google Cloud sessions. cloud. gcloud. Learn how to compile and run the C++ client examples in Cloud Shell using micromamba and Conda. For a list of gcloud CLI features, see All features. Go to VM instances. Sep 10, 2024 · The cloudshell command allows you to accomplish tasks like launching tutorials, downloading files, setting aliases, and opening existing files in the code editor from the Cloud Shell command line. Sep 10, 2024 · In the Google Cloud console, on the project selector page, select or create a Google Cloud project. Learn more about AWS CloudShell, a browser-based shell that makes it easy to securely manage, explore, and interact with your AWS resources. Go to APIs. Send feedback Except as otherwise noted, the content of this page is licensed under the Creative Commons Attribution 4. Oct 29, 2020 · With Cloud Shell Editor, we want to make it easy for you to explore new cloud technologies, prototype applications or do short-term development tasks directly from your browser. . Sep 10, 2024 · The Cloud Shell Editor can be launched in different ways to best fit your use case. Click the open in Cloud Shell button below to run a sample tutorial yourself. For more information, see Shell sessions. The Google Cloud CLI includes the gcloud, gsutil and bq command-line tools. This tutorial is adapted from https Sep 10, 2024 · To work with the Cloud Shell Editor, follow these steps: Launch the Cloud Shell Editor by clicking Open Editor on the toolbar of the Cloud Shell window. Sep 10, 2024 · After installation is complete, the installer gives you the option to create Start Menu and Desktop shortcuts, start the Google Cloud CLI shell, and configure the gcloud CLI. Posted in. Sep 10, 2024 · Google Cloud SDK, languages, frameworks, and tools Infrastructure as code Migration Google Cloud Home To customize the color theme of your Cloud Shell Editor: Sep 10, 2024 · Cloud Shell is a shell environment with the Google Cloud CLI already installed and with values already set for your current project. Click the following button to open Cloud Shell, which provides command-line access to your Google Cloud resources directly from the browser. Launch a standalone Cloud Shell Editor session. Note: To propagate your credentials to your Cloud Shell when starting it from the Google Cloud CLI, use the --authorize-session flag when running the gcloud cloud-shell ssh command. In addition to the performance and cost advantages of doing this, copying in the cloud preserves metadata such as Content-Type and Cache-Control . A Cloud Shell session opens inside a new frame at the bottom of the Google Cloud console and displays a command-line prompt. Sep 10, 2024 · Clone the sample repo and open the sample application in Cloud Shell: Go to Cloud Shell. When you use Cloud Shell, you don't need to sign in to the gcloud CLI, but you do need to authorize the use of your account before using any development tools from Cloud Shell. A Cloud project forms the basis for creating, enabling, and using all Google Cloud services, including managing APIs, enabling billing, adding and removing collaborators, and managing permissions. The Cloud9 terminal provides a browser-based shell experience enabling you to install additional software, do a git push, or enter commands. Create a Cloud project Google Cloud console Aug 19, 2024 · Shell session management. If you're new to Google Cloud, create an account to evaluate how our products perform in real-world scenarios. Google Cloud uses quotas to help ensure fairness and reduce spikes in resource use and availability. Cloud Shell VM の Zone 6 days ago · Google Cloud SDK, languages, frameworks, and tools Infrastructure as code Migration Google Cloud Home Free Trial and Free Tier Architecture Center Blog Contact Sales Google Cloud Developer Center Google Developer Center Google Cloud Marketplace Google Cloud Marketplace Documentation Google Cloud Skills Boost Sep 10, 2024 · In the Google Cloud console, go to the APIs page. ) Cheat sheet Cloud Shell is free for users with a Google Cloud account. Find out how to scroll, copy, paste, configure, and customize your terminal settings and sessions. Sep 10, 2024 · The tutorial shows you how to run commands in Cloud Shell; if you use the Google Cloud CLI on your workstation, adjust the instructions accordingly. For example, to move a file, 'data. Available positional arguments for cloudshell are as follows: Sep 10, 2024 · When Cloud Shell is started, the active project in Cloud Shell is propagated to your gcloud configuration inside Cloud Shell for immediate use. In the Google Cloud console, activate Cloud Shell. The easiest way to start a Cloud Shell session and begin using Cloud Shell Editor is to directly launch a Cloud Shell Editor session with ide. This page is for IT administrators, Operators, and Developers who set up, monitor, and manage cloud infrastructure, and provision and configure cloud resources. Feb 2, 2023 · 1. com. Get started with Cloud Shell. Before you begin. It can take a few seconds for the session to initialize. You can also print instructions to the terminal to help users interact with the content. We would like to show you a description here but the site won’t allow us. Sep 10, 2024 · gcloud init; In the Google Cloud console, on the project selector page, select or create a Google Cloud project. You will learn how to use Cloud Shell and the Cloud SDK gcloud command. Sep 10, 2024 · For a step-by-step guide to building basic scripts with the gcloud CLI, see this blog post: Scripting with gcloud: a beginner’s guide to automating Google Cloud tasks. See full list on cloud. Activate Cloud Shell. Sep 10, 2024 · Mount your Cloud Shell directory to your local file system via sshfs. Sep 10, 2024 · This page explains how to install and configure the kubectl command-line tool, and how to troubleshoot common setup issues. Quotas apply to a range of resource types, including hardware, software, and network Sep 10, 2024 · If both the source and destination URL are cloud URLs from the same provider, gsutil copies data "in the cloud" (without downloading to and uploading from the machine where you run gsutil). Nov 2, 2020 · Cloud Shell エディタは完全な機能を備えた開発ツールであり、ローカルの設定は不要でブラウザから直接利用できます。Cloud Shell エディタが他の Google Cloud デベロッパー エコシステムとどのように統合されているかを詳しく見ていきましょう。 Sep 10, 2024 · Cloud Shell is a shell environment with the Google Cloud CLI already installed and with values already set for your current project. Note : If you don't plan to keep the resources that you create in this procedure, create a project instead of selecting an existing project. Start a new session. After you do that, the gcloud CLI uses your user credentials to access Google APIs. Try the Pricing calculator. Safe Paste is enabled by default. aofigo aezuasxf zwkw xoej cve gnnyh pfmkp bddhu bhy zpwq